Subject: [Qemu-devel] [PATCH 4/6] target-i386: postpone cpuid_level update to realize time

From: Igor Mammedov <imammedo@redhat.com>

delay capping cpuid_level to 7 to realize time so property setters
for cpuid_7_0_ebx_features and "level" could be used in any order/time
between x86_cpu_initfn() and x86_cpu_realize().

Signed-off-by: Igor Mammedov <imammedo@redhat.com>
---
 target-i386/cpu.c | 8 +++++---
 1 file changed, 5 insertions(+), 3 deletions(-)

diff --git a/target-i386/cpu.c b/target-i386/cpu.c
index 05ac79a..56a5646 100644
--- a/target-i386/cpu.c
+++ b/target-i386/cpu.c
@@ -1381,9 +1381,6 @@ static int cpu_x86_parse_featurestr(x86_def_t *x86_cpu_def, char *features)
         if (kvm_check_features_against_host(x86_cpu_def) && enforce_cpuid)
             goto error;
     }
-    if (x86_cpu_def->cpuid_7_0_ebx_features && x86_cpu_def->level < 7) {
-        x86_cpu_def->level = 7;
-    }
     return 0;
 
 error:
@@ -2074,6 +2071,11 @@ static void x86_cpu_apic_init(X86CPU *cpu, Error **errp)
 void x86_cpu_realize(Object *obj, Error **errp)
 {
     X86CPU *cpu = X86_CPU(obj);
+    CPUX86State *env = &cpu->env;
+
+    if (env->cpuid_7_0_ebx_features && env->cpuid_level < 7) {
+        env->cpuid_level = 7;
+    }
 
 #ifndef CONFIG_USER_ONLY
     qemu_register_reset(x86_cpu_machine_reset_cb, cpu);
